CVE-2025-47511 | WordPress Welcart e-Commerce plugin <= 2.11.13 - Arbitrary File Deletion Vulnerability

Improper Limitation of a Pathname to a Restricted Directory ('Path Traversal') vulnerability in info@welcart Welcart e-Commerce usc-e-shop allows Path Traversal.This issue affects Welcart e-Commerce: from n/a through <= 2.11.13.

6.8 3.1 MEDIUM
C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:H/UI:N/S:C/C:N/I:N/A:H Click to expand
Attack vector (AV:N)
Could be attacked over the internet or any normal routed network—not just someone sitting at the machine.
Attack complexity (AC:L)
Once they can reach the bug, pulling it off is straightforward—no weird race conditions or rare setup.
Privileges required (PR:H)
They need powerful rights—admin, root, or similar—before this pays off.
User interaction (UI:N)
Nobody has to click “OK” or open a trap file; it can work without a victim helping.
Scope (S:C)
Breaking this can reach past the original component and bite other resources—bigger blast radius.
Confidentiality (C:N)
Doesn’t really leak secrets in a meaningful way.
Integrity (I:N)
Data isn’t meaningfully altered or forged.
Availability (A:H)
Could take the service down hard or make it unusable for people who depend on it.
